Can gut microbes save patients from chemotherapy side effects?

Researchers at UCSF found that certain gut bacteria can reduce chemotherapy side effects by clearing excess drugs and producing the protective vitamin K2. Patients with more beneficial bacteria had fewer side effects, suggesting that probiotics may help mitigate chemotherapy's impact.

Why so many microbes fail to grow in the lab

A new study from researchers at the Helmholtz Institute for Functional Marine Biodiversity offers fresh insights into why many microorganisms fail to grow in the lab. The study suggests that the survival of microbes depends on a hidden web of relationships between species, which can collapse with small structural changes.

Protein sources change the gut microbiome – some drastically

A new study reveals that protein sources in an animal's diet significantly alter the gut microbiome, with some having extreme effects. The researchers found that diets high in brown rice, yeast, or egg whites led to changes in amino acid metabolism and complex sugar degradation.

Microorganisms employ a secret weapon during metabolism

A study found that microorganisms using the reductive tricarboxylic acid cycle dominate in shallow-water hydrothermal systems. This energy-efficient process enables them to transfer carbon into organic molecules, allowing them to survive in harsh conditions.

Titanium particles are common around implants

A new study from the University of Gothenburg found that titanium micro-particles are consistently present at all examined implants, even those without signs of inflammation. The researchers identified 14 genes that may be affected by these particles, but further research is needed to understand their impact on tissue health.

Scientists discover new microbes in Earth’s deep soil

Researchers found a new phylum of microbes, CSP1-3, thriving in deep Critical Zone soils, cleaning up impurities and regulating essential processes. The microbes were active, not dormant, and dominated their environments, making up 50% or more of the community.

Protective radar for bacteria

A research team has identified a previously unknown defense mechanism in Pseudomonas syringae, enabling the bacterium to produce chemical compounds that attract amoebae, which are then killed by toxic substances produced by the bacteria. This 'chemical radar' system also helps the bacteria infect plants in the presence of predators.

Microbial manners on the high seas

A new study found that microbes in the Sargasso Sea take turns using phosphorus, a critical nutrient for growth, to avoid competition between species. This temporal resource partitioning strategy supports coexistence and efficient nutrient use in this oligotrophic region.

Without oxygen: How primordial microbes breathed

Ancient bacteria can respire carbon dioxide and hydrogen into acetic acid to produce ATP. A new mechanism involving sodium ions is activated when acetic acid is produced, driving a molecular turbine that generates energy.

Efficiently and sustainably killing bacteria

A new electrocatalytic sterilization method has been introduced using copper oxide nanowires to produce highly alkaline microenvironments that efficiently kill bacteria. Most conventional disinfection methods have disadvantages such as harmful by-products and high energy consumption.

Signs of alien life may be hiding in these gases

Researchers identify methyl halides as a potential sign of microbial life on Hycean planets with thick hydrogen atmospheres. The gas could accumulate in exoplanet atmospheres and be detectable from light-years away, offering an optimal strategy for the search for extraterrestrial life.

$1.9M NIH grant will allow researchers to explore how copper kills bacteria

The University of Arizona College of Medicine – Tucson laboratory is working on discovering new ways to neutralize harmful microorganisms using copper. The researchers aim to understand how copper kills bacteria by flooding their environment with excess copper, tricking them into building essential proteins with the wrong materials.
